Me and my friend (both women) stayed in a mixed 9-bed-dorm for 3 nights. Unfortunately, we are unable to agree with all these positive reviews and here’s why: 1. The bathroom was covered in black mold. There was black mold everywhere on the walls and in the shower. After telling the receptionist, they sent someone to “get rid of it”. Eventually, someone had poured bleach over it and scrubbed it until it was superficially gone. However, not even a day later you could literally see the spots growing back because this cleaning method is obviously not how you get rid of mold which has probably been there for a really long time. This was honestly very shocking because this isn’t only a sanitary problem, this is legit a health hazard which should be taken seriously! 2. The breakfast. The breakfast is by far not worth what they charge you for. If you wake up even a little after 9:30, half of the buffet is empty and is not being refilled. At 10:45, the buffet was entirely cleaned up by the staff although it is supposed to last until 11:00. Furthermore, it isn’t tasty. You get dry toast with some store-bought jam and cheap spreads. 3. the Service. In comparison to other Ostello Bellos in differnt cities most of the staff wasn't really friendly in Florence. When asking for help, like getting new toilet paper when it was empty in our room, no one felt responsible to do their job. There were only one or two volunteers that were nice and helpful. Furthermore, the people at the reception could not help us when asking about basic information about Florence like directions or prices for taxis etc as they did not know the city either, which we feel should be a basic requirement for people working at a hostel. 4. Bathrooms. When booking a room please be aware, that there is only one bathroom in the dorm room, which is a joint shower, toilet and sink. There are two more toilets in the common area, but no other showers. So when someone is occupying the bathroom in the dorm, you have to wait until they are finished which could take a long time. Overall, there certainly are better hostels in the city. However the location is a huge plus, because everything is in walking distance from the hostel. Florence as a city is amazing, Ostello Bello Florence however has room for improvent.…
